If you’ve got roughly $200 burning a hole in your pocket, the “Nano” edition of Crysis 2 might just be up your alley.

The special edition bundle was outed by Swedish retailer Webhallen, and spotted by German gaming site Playfront before it was yanked. What does two bills get you? A seven-inch “Prophet” statue, a 176-page art book, some sort of “SCAR” hologram, unlockable ranks and items for multiplayer, and a little backpack designed to look like the game’s nano-suit. All of this in fancy tin, of course.

Since the listing was pulled, there’s no word as to where the “Nano” edition will crop up around the globe. Europe seems like a lock, but we’ll have to wait to hear word from publisher Electronic Arts to see if we’ll be getting the bundle in North America.
